Common Problems: HYUNDAI IX35
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- DPF, EGR and boost-hose issues on CRDi diesels(Moderate)
Short-trip use and neglected servicing lead to blocked DPFs, sticky EGR valves and split boost hoses, causing limp mode and recurring warning lights.
- AWD coupling and rear differential wear(Moderate)
On four-wheel-drive models, neglected tyres or missed fluid changes can strain the coupling and rear diff, producing whine, vibration or judder on tight turns.
